Mesodermal cells at the site of the limb buds respond to beads soaked in FGF8 and grow out along the
proximal-distal axis. If beads expressing FGF8 are placed under the epithelium of the back there is no
outgrowth. This experiment demonstrates which of the following?
- Permissive induction
- Proliferation
- Competence
- Gastrulation
- Differentiation - CORRECT ANSWER-✔✔✅- Competence
LEC 1.3 Slide 6
"Competence: a cell's ability to respond to an inductive signal."
Think about this: the soaked Fgf8 beads are transplanted 'under the epithelium of the BACK ... [and]
there is NO outgrowth."
Because there is no outgrowth when this is translated, this means the cells of the back are not
competent. Meaning, their signals are there/present from Fgf8, however, the cell's (of the back)
ability to comprehend and exact the goals of the Fgf8 signal is inadequate or incompetent.
textbook:
Cells of the responding tissue must have both a receptor protein for the inducing factor and the ability
to respond to the signal. The ability to receive and respond to a specific inductive signal is called
competence (Waddington 1940).
